#include <iostream>
#include <list>
#include <vector>
#include <algorithm>
using namespace std;
int main()
{
list<int> ilst;
cout << "Enter some numbers:" << endl;
int val;
while (cin >> val) {
ilst.push_back(val);
}
vector<int> ivec;
ilst.sort();
unique_copy(ilst.begin(), ilst.end(), back_inserter(ivec));
for (vector<int>::iterator it = ivec.begin(); it != ivec.end(); ++it)
{
cout << *it << " ";
}
cout << endl;
getchar();
return 0;
}
STL unique_copy demo
最新推荐文章于 2025-07-06 22:32:09 发布